# Artifact Signing — Canary Gating (Harkenwell Platform)

All canary deploys on Harkenwell require signed artifacts before the gating rules evaluate error budgets. Unsigned builds are blocked at stage zero; gating then checks latency and error thresholds over a 30-minute window. Security reviewers should verify signatures against the active release key, reproduced below.

rollout seal: bky4_x7Gc

## Releases

QuillGraph 3.2 eliminates the N+1 resolver pattern in nested list fields. Plugin authors: rebuild against the new batch-loader API; legacy per-row resolvers are deprecated and will warn until 4.0. Releases follow semver and publish to the Fennwick registry every second Tuesday. All packages are signed; reject anything unsigned in your build chain. Validate downloads using the public key that follows.

deploy key for kajof-fajop: bky6_gDHw9Q

## Reportline Environments — Timezone Handling

Three environments: dev, staging, prod. Exports render timestamps in the account's configured zone; dev and staging default to a fixed test zone to keep snapshot diffs stable. Prod resolves zones per tenant. Known gap: scheduled exports created before v2.4 still assume the server zone — backfill pending. Release manager: do not promote a build unless the timezone regression suite passes in staging first. Staging runs with the following values.

service settings:
[ulair]
team = praath
access_code = ac_06d704
owner = wenix.ulair
host = ulair.qirvancorp.corp
port = 9200
peer = sorys.nelvronet.internal
salt = 2668132c
pin = 9140

Confirm the script does not evaluate string contents, which previously allowed template injection into the Tarnbrook build. Check that its dependency manifest is pinned and that output bundles are checksummed before handoff to translators. Evidence should include the last three pipeline run logs. Direct all findings to the script owner, whose full name appears below.

named custodian: Brivan Eliath Quenox Frador